Bismarck, N.D. October 5, 2006 – The Dakota Wizards announced today that several former Wizards players are in NBA training camps. The NBA season begins on October 31st as the Chicago Bulls visit the defending champion Miami Heat and the Phoenix Suns travel to Los Angeles to take on the Lakers.
Following is the list of former Wizards players on 2006-07 NBA training camp rosters:
| Player | NBA Team |
| Kaniel Dickens | Atlanta Hawks |
| Sean Lampley | Indiana Pacers |
| Melvin Sanders | San Antonio Spurs |
| Kasib Powell | Orlando Magic |
“We wish all of our former players luck as they pursue their dream of playing in the NBA,” said Wizards Head Coach David Joerger. “If it turns out that any of them require more development to take their game to the next level, there's a chance we will see them back in the Bismarck Civic Center as we enter our first season in the NBA Development League.”
The Dakota Wizards are affiliated with the Chicago Bulls and the Washington Wizards, which have a combined eight former D-League players on their training camp rosters.
